Prerequisites and Requirements for Scuba Certification

To get scuba certified, you must meet certain scuba certification requirements. These rules are to keep you safe underwater. They help you get ready for diving and lower risks.

Age and Health Requirements

You must be at least 15 years old (10 for junior certifications) and healthy. You’ll need to answer a health questionnaire. This is to check if any health issues might be a problem while diving.

Swimming Abilities Needed

You don’t have to be a great swimmer, but you should be okay in the water. You’ll need to show you can float or tread water for a bit. And swim a little distance on your own.

These skills are key for beginner scuba diving certification. They help you stay safe in the water.

The Cost of Getting Scuba Certified

Scuba diving certification is an investment in your underwater adventures. It’s important to know the costs involved. The total cost includes course fees, equipment, and sometimes travel expenses for training dives.

Course Fees Breakdown

The course fee is a big part of the cost. It covers instruction, facilities, and equipment rental for training sessions. On average, a scuba diving certification course can cost between $400 to $600. This depends on the certification agency, location, and the specific course.

Here’s a rough breakdown of what you might expect to pay for:

  • Classroom sessions and materials: $100-$200
  • Confined water training: $100-$150
  • Open water dives: $200-$300

Equipment Investment Considerations

Some courses may include equipment rental. But, you’ll need to buy your own scuba diving gear if you plan to dive often. The initial investment in basic equipment can range from $500 to $1,000. This depends on the quality and brand of the gear.

Start with the essentials like a mask, snorkel, fins, and a wetsuit. As you get more experience, you can add more advanced equipment. Buying second-hand or renting gear are also good ways to save money.

Common Challenges for Beginners

Beginners might struggle with staying buoyant, equalizing ear pressure, and finding their way underwater. To beat these, stay calm, listen to your instructor, and practice a lot. For more tips, check out PADI’s guide on how to scuba. It has great advice on the scuba certification process.

  • Staying relaxed during dives
  • Practicing buoyancy control
  • Mastering equalization techniques
